The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Refurbishment

Worldwide of home improvement, the term "composite door refurbishment" incorporates a vital aspect of preserving and enhancing the aesthetic appeal, performance, and security of houses. Composite doors, made from a combination of materials such as wood, uPVC, and insulating foam, are renowned for their sturdiness, thermal efficiency, and low maintenance requirements. Nevertheless, like any structural element of a home, they can show wear over time. This article checks out the value, methodologies, and benefits of reconditioning composite doors, while likewise addressing regularly asked questions.

Why Refurbish Composite Doors?

1. Aesthetic Appeal: One of the primary factors property owners choose to refurbish their composite doors is to bring back or improve look. With time, exposure to elements can lead to fading or staining. With refurbishment, owners can upgrade the look of their doors without the cost of complete replacement.

2. Enhanced Performance: As doors age, their seals can degrade, resulting in drafts and energy inefficiencies. Refurbishment can address these problems, restoring the door to its initial performance levels.

3. Cost-Effectiveness: Refurbishing a composite door is generally less expensive than a total replacement. This makes it a useful choice for those aiming to keep their home without undergoing a substantial financial investment.

4. Environmental Benefits: Refurbishing adds to sustainability by minimizing waste. Instead of discarding an old door, refurbishment keeps it in usage, decreasing the need for brand-new materials.

Key Steps in Composite Door Refurbishment

Reconditioning a composite door typically includes several essential actions. Listed below, we lay out an uncomplicated technique to finish this procedure effectively:

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Before initiating refurbishment, an extensive evaluation of the door is fundamental. Homeowners ought to look for:

  • Signs of wear, such as scratches, dents, or fading paint.
  • Damage to the seals or locking mechanisms.
  • Any signs of rot or insect problem (particularly if the door has wooden components).

Step 2: Cleaning

Cleaning up the door is vital in preparing it for refurbishment. House owners can utilize a mix of mild soap and water, together with non-abrasive cloths, to carefully clean the door. A gentle scrub can get rid of dirt, gunk, and mildew, exposing any hidden damage.

Action 3: Repairs

As soon as the door is clean, any essential repairs must be dealt with. This may include:

  • Replacing or repairing door seals to improve insulation.
  • Repairing or replacing hinges as needed.
  • Touching up paint or varnish where required.

Step 4: Repainting or Re-staining

Depending upon the desired finish, property owners can either repaint or re-stain the door:

  • For painting: Choose an appropriate exterior-grade paint that matches the total home color pattern. Dry completely before applying a 2nd coat.
  • For re-staining: Use a quality wood stain that protects and enhances natural functions, followed by a protective sealant.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Maintenance Tips

After refurbishment, house owners ought to conduct a last examination to guarantee all aspects are secure and functional. Regular maintenance, such as lubrication of hinges and examine weather condition seals, can prolong the door's lifespan.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How frequently should I refurbish my composite door?

Q2: Can I refurbish my composite door myself?

A2: Yes, lots of house owners can carry out standard refurbishment jobs themselves, such as cleansing, painting, and sealing. Nevertheless, engaging a professional is suggested for comprehensive repairs or if electrical elements are included.

Q3: What products do I require for refurbishment?

A3: Essential items consist of:

  • Mild soap and water for cleaning up
  • Exterior-grade paint or wood stain
  • Door seals and lubricants for hardware
  • Sandpaper or wood filler for surface area repairs

Q4: How can I prevent more wear and tear after refurbishment?

A4: Regular maintenance is essential. This might include periodic cleaning, examining seals for wear, and ensuring hinges are lubed. Keeping the door devoid of particles, specifically in locations vulnerable to moisture, can also help.
